Default opinion on my build

started with 2003 txt 36v and a unknown model ezgo industrial cart 48v.

ok I am using the 03 txt my parts

Curtis 1205 from 48v cart 350amp
stock 36v motor
stock fr switch
hd 36v solenoid
oversized cables

my questions for you experts
since my controller will do 48v should I put 48v to the 36v motor or just use the 48v motor? I have 8 6v batteries.

second is my list of parts ok for 350 amp 48v conversion?

I am not looking for extreme performance my neighborhood is hilly so little extra torque and speed would be nice.

please any input is appreciated I am on a budget but when I am done I want it to be right.

Default Re: opinion on my build

You will get some improvement in performance running the 36v motor on 48v but, the 36v solenoid and stock F&R may not last very long.
